Connor Wong went 4-for-5 with a double and an RBI in the Red Sox's 10-6 loss to the Cardinals.
Fantasy Impact
This performance underscores Wong's strong season, as he continues to maintain an impressive .362 batting average. His consistent hitting, evidenced by his 38 hits and five home runs over 30 games, makes him a valuable asset in fantasy lineups, particularly in formats that reward hitting for average and extra-base hits. While his lack of stolen bases and minimal walks might limit his upside in categories leagues, his high wOBA (.400) indicates significant offensive production, making him a solid option in most fantasy formats.

Connor Wong went 3-for-4 with a run scored and an RBI in the Red Sox's 6-2 win over the Giants.
Fantasy Impact
His performance included two doubles, contributing significantly to the team's offense. This game continues a strong season for Wong, who now boasts a .366 batting average. While his low walk rate might be a concern for some, his slugging ability and knack for driving in runs can offset that, particularly in formats that prioritize power stats and RBIs.
